Raj Bhawan, Civil Sect & venues to be visited by LG declared “no fly zone”

JAMMU, JULY 08: District Magistrate, Jammu, Anshul Garg, in exercise of powers vested to him under Section 144 Cr. PC, has declared Raj Bhawan, Jammu & Civil Secretariat, Jammu as  ”No Fly Zone”- strictly prohibiting flying of Drones & Unmanned Aerial Vehicles (UAVs) over & above these premises with immediate effect.

As per an order, there shall also be complete prohibition on flying of Drones & Unmanned Aerial Vehicles (UAVs) over all areas/venues in District Jammu as & when Lieutenant Governor is scheduled to visit in connection with holding of events.

“Since it is not possible to serve individual notices to all the persons concerned, this order is being passed ex-parte” the order stated.

Sr. Superintendent of Police, Jammu shall ensure implementation of this order in letter and spirit.

The move, as per the order, has come “In view of the security threat posed due to recent trends of carrying out drone attacks by anti-National Elements.”
